[Old software maxim: hardware is cheap, software is expensive] 2 hours to render @ 1,500 samples, GPU [Used to be 16 hours, CPU] Interiors have extreme lighting so this seemed a good test for Filmic Blender. You can get Troy Sobotka's Filmic Blender here: I was quite pleased how much of the exterior detail was made available. I adjusted the colour grade, no other changes. Trying for a wintry feel. Impressively, Filmic Blender allows for a lot of post-processing. The highlights can be pushed quite far without blowing-out. [Check the shadow border, side face of the sofa which used to look a little nasty.] I am sure the same is true for the shadows. A big thumbs-up from me. |
